Understanding Cashmere's Legacy
Before delving into blends, it's crucial to appreciate the singular qualities of pure cashmere. Originating from the delicate undercoat of the Himalayan cashmere goat, this fiber is renowned for its fine texture, natural warmth, and luxurious softness. The production process is labor-intensive, as it often involves carefully hand-combing the goats during their molting season. These steps ensure the fiber's quality and exclusivity, hence its status as a luxury fabric.
Despite its undoubted allure, pure cashmere poses certain limitations: Durability Concerns: While incredibly soft, cashmere is prone to pilling and may not withstand rigorous use as well as more robust fibers. Climate Impositions: Cashmere is highly regarded for its warmth but isn't ideally suited for warmer climates, limiting its utility in fluctuating weather conditions.
The Role of Blends in Fashion
Fashion enthusiasts and textile developers have recognized the potential of combining cashmere with other fibers to overcome its inherent limitations. Blending allows for the creation of garments that capitalize on cashmere's luxurious properties while also integrating other fiber's strengths.
Wool and Cashmere Blends: When interwoven with wool, cashmere retains its softness and warmth, while gaining enhanced durability and elasticity. Wool blends make for more resilient garments that age gracefully over time, retaining their form and feel.
Silk and Cashmere Blends: Blending cashmere with silk brings out an opulent sheen and drape, crafting garments that feel light, breathable, and perfect for transitional or layered looks in varying seasons.
Cotton and Cashmere Blends: Combining cashmere with cotton results in softer, breathable fabrics ideal for spring and autumn wear. This blend can provide moisture-wicking properties and better air circulation, making garments versatile and comfortable.
Linen and Cashmere Blends: Linen's crispness and cashmere's warmth create a unique balance, offering garments that are breathable yet cozy. Such blends are excellent for creating summer apparel that delivers a hint of luxury.
Advantages of Cashmere Blends
Economical Benefits: Blends can bring down costs, allowing wider accessibility to the luxe feel of cashmere while still maintaining excellent fabric quality.
Enhanced Strength and Longevity: Blending introduces fibers that improve tensile strength and resilience, prolonging an item's life.
Versatility and Seasonal Usability: By combining cashmere with other fibers, garments become suitable for diverse climates and events.
Sustainability and Ethical Considerations
In recent years, consumers have become more mindful of ethical production and sustainability in fashion. The development of cashmere blends offers the potential for reduced environmental impact.
Reducing Waste: Blending can utilize shorter fibers from the combing process, reducing textile waste.
Ethical Sourcing: Responsible sourcing of all fibers in a blend, coupled with ethical production standards, gains consumer trust and builds brand authenticity.
